Theme and Gameplay
Looting Raccoons Online Video Slot puts a mischievous pirate crew at the center of the action, with Captain Bandit and Quartermaster Rascal leading the raid. Million Games gives the slot a bright seafaring style, mixing treasure chests, ship details, and playful character art with a high-volatility setup.
The game starts on a 5×3 layout with 243 ways to win, but the reel structure can expand up to 972 ways through duplication features. Slot Features
The Captain Bandit and Quartermaster Rascal Wilds are more than simple substitutes. Their nudging behavior can trigger Sneaky Wild Respins, locking the action into a more suspenseful sequence while multipliers build with each movement.
Three Free Spin Scatter symbols trigger Raccoon Power Free Spins, which use a dedicated bonus reel set and give the nudging Wild system more room to develop. The game can also trigger Raccoon Heist Super Free Spins when the two main characters meet, awarding a stronger 15-spin mode that carries over multiplier value.
Reel duplication can expand the number of ways to win, and the Bonus Buy option gives eligible players a faster route into the features. Between the expanding ways, Wild Respins, multipliers, and two free-spin modes, Looting Raccoons has more mechanical bite than its playful theme first suggests.
